Our Mission to Help Meet a Growing Community Need

Since 1981, Samaritan Counseling Centers of the Mid-South has offered hope and healing by providing affordable, accessible, high-quality, professional counseling and educational resources, while respecting the personal and spiritual values of individuals. We also provide high-quality mental health educational resources. Forty-four years after our founding, the need for mental health services has been on the rise:

  • More than 1 in 5 adults (21%) in the United States experiences mental illness each year, representing over 50 million people dealing with conditions ranging from anxiety to severe depression (Mental Health America, 2023).
  • More than 4 in 10 (42%) U.S. high school students felt persistently sad or hopeless and nearly one-third (29%) experienced poor mental health (CDC, 2021).
  • Approximately 50% of all adults and children who suffer from a mental health challenge do not have access to care (MHA, 2023).
  • Tennessee ranks 43rd in access to mental health care in the U.S. (MHA, 2024).
  •  Cost of care remains a significant barrier for many individuals. With the average cost of a counseling session in Tennessee of $130-$150, and many providers choosing to not accept insurance, counseling is out of reach for so many.

Samaritan Counseling Centers of the Mid-South is committed to increasing access to mental health counseling and educational services by providing a sliding scale fee structure and a client assistance fund that allows us to offset the cost of services for lower-paying clients and lower-reimbursing insurance payments. We serve clients throughout the Mid-South (71 zip codes in 2024) from all racial and economic backgrounds, including those with low incomes, no insurance or low-reimbursing insurance.
